Webbirth·day rule ( bĭrth'dā rūl) A principle involving coordination of benefits of health insurance plans to determine which insurance plan should cover costs of health care for dependent … WebFeb 16, 2024 · Under the birthday rule, the health plan of the parent whose birthday comes first in the calendar year is designated as the primary plan, according to the National Association of Insurance Commissioners. It doesnt matter which parent is older. The year of birth isnt a factor.
